Embracing the Essence of Spanish Style
Spanish style outdoor patio furniture is characterized by its use of natural materials, warm colors, and intricate patterns. Think wrought iron, terracotta, and vibrant ceramics. The focus is on creating a space that feels both luxurious and comfortable, encouraging a slower pace of life. This style often incorporates elements of Moorish design, such as ornate carvings and geometric patterns, adding a touch of exotic flair.
Key Elements of Spanish Style Patio Furniture
- Wrought Iron: This durable and elegant material is a staple in Spanish design. From intricately designed chairs and tables to decorative accents, wrought iron adds a touch of timeless sophistication. Consider pairing wrought iron furniture with cushions for vintage wrought iron furniture for added comfort and a pop of color.
- Terracotta: The warm, earthy tones of terracotta create a welcoming atmosphere. Use terracotta pots, tiles, and other decorative elements to infuse your patio with a touch of rustic charm.
- Vibrant Ceramics: Add a splash of color with vibrant ceramic tiles, pottery, and other decorative accents. Bold patterns and rich hues, such as blues, greens, and yellows, are characteristic of Spanish style.
- Natural Materials: Embrace natural materials like wood and stone to create a harmonious and organic feel. Good quality wood for furniture can be incorporated through tables, benches, or decorative accents.
- Textiles: Add comfort and style with colorful cushions, throws, and rugs. Choose fabrics with bold patterns and textures to enhance the overall aesthetic.

Completing the Look with Spanish Flair
Consider adding a touch of greenery with potted plants, such as olive trees, citrus trees, and bougainvillea. These plants thrive in warm climates and add to the Mediterranean aesthetic. Enhance your spanish home exterior to complement your patio furniture.
“The key is to create a space that feels lived-in and inviting,” says Javier Rodriguez, a landscape architect specializing in Spanish gardens. “Think about incorporating elements that engage all the senses – the scent of fragrant flowers, the sound of a trickling fountain, and the visual appeal of vibrant colors and textures.”

FAQ
Can I use Spanish style furniture in a colder climate? Yes, with proper care and storage during the off-season, you can enjoy Spanish style furniture in any climate.
What are some good color combinations for Spanish style patios? Warm earth tones, such as terracotta and beige, paired with vibrant blues, greens, and yellows, create a classic Spanish palette.
What type of lighting works well with Spanish style patios? Wrought iron lanterns, string lights, and candles create a warm and inviting ambiance.
Are there any maintenance considerations for wrought iron furniture? Regular cleaning and occasional repainting will help maintain the beauty and durability of your wrought iron furniture.
How can I incorporate water features into my Spanish style patio? A small fountain or a tiled water feature can add a soothing and refreshing element to your patio.
